Summary

New Relic Instant Observability (I/O) has launched an open ecosystem of free, pre-built quickstarts that enable engineers to start monitoring their stacks in minutes without manual setup. The platform includes over 425 quickstarts for popular cloud services, tools, and open standards, as well as integrations from leading enterprise software partners such as Delphix, Speedscale, Amazon SageMaker, Algorithmia, Aporia, Comet, DAGsHub, Monalabs, Superwise, and Truera. These quickstarts provide instant observability for CI/CD, Kubernetes testing, AI/ML model monitoring, and other use cases, allowing engineers to visualize and monitor their data in one platform. The platform also enables users to bring their own ML data into New Relic One and integrate it with the rest of the application components, including infrastructure.
